Chemical Properties of Pipecolic acid, N-isoBOC TBDMS

Pipecolic acid, N-isoBOC TBDMS

InChI
InChI=1S/C17H33NO4Si/c1-13(2)12-21-16(20)18-11-9-8-10-14(18)15(19)22-23(6,7)17(3,4)5/h13-14H,8-12H2,1-7H3
InChI Key
OAJDWZCNOVIFBN-UHFFFAOYSA-N
Formula
C17H33NO4Si
SMILES
CC(C)COC(=O)N1CCCCC1C(=O)O[Si](C)(C)C(C)(C)C
Molecular Weight1
343.53

Physical Properties

Property Value Unit Source
ω 0.7112 Relay (1.0) Calculated Property
Δf -253.88 kJ/mol Relay (1.0-beta) Calculated Property
Δfgas -1046.98 kJ/mol Relay (1.0) Calculated Property
Δvap 78.51 kJ/mol Relay (1.0) Calculated Property
IE 8.86 eV Relay (1.0) Calculated Property
log10WS -3.20 Relay (1.0) Calculated Property
logPoct/wat 4.182 Crippen Calculated Property
Pc 1211.45 kPa Relay (1.0-beta) Calculated Property
Inp 1976.00 NIST
Tboil 606.02 K Relay (1.0) Calculated Property
Tc 817.15 K Relay (1.0) Calculated Property
Tfus 346.33 K Relay (1.0) Calculated Property
Vc 1.056 m3/kmol Relay (1.0) Calculated Property
